There are times in your life when all you can say is ahhhhhhhh and just smile. I had one of those days last week, things were busy, I was at work when a fellow nurse walked up to me and handed me her cell phone and said "here YOU talk to this person" now that in itself makes one want to do exactly the opposite, but I took the phone and said "hello". On the other end of the phone came a sweet little voice that I hadn't heard for a while saying "Hello boss". It was a nurse that I had worked with a while back.
My first thought was oh great I hope she is looking for a job, cause I could sure use a good nurse. Well the next thing I heard was Evelyn say, "hey boss guess what............I have a new baby!" And that's when the ahhhhhhhhhhhhhh moment happened. Now it's pretty normal for women to get excited about a new baby, but this was extra special.
Evelyn is from the Philippines, her husband John is a really nice guy that I have met several times. John and Evelyn have been trying to start a family for several years now. There first baby died shortly after birth (I don't know why), her second pregnancy ended with a miscarriage and her third ended when she miscarried twins. As you can imagine, they were both devastated.
I had heard that they were talking about adoption, but I hadn't seen Evelyn in about 5 or 6 months and the last time I saw her she wasn't pregnant. So this phone call was a big surprise to me.
"Ohhhhh that's wonderful Evelyn", I said in the phone. Then she went on to tell me how they had adopted this sweet baby girl that they named Mia. She told me that her and John were there when the baby was born and that they brought her home from the hospital just three days ago. She told me how much she weighed, how long she was, how loud she was when she cried and how all she did was sleep and eat and mess her diapers LOL. I said "well that's what babies do" I made her promise to send pictures and she did. What an adorable little girl and how lucky she is to be part of this loving family. And that my friends is my ahhhhhhhhh moment.
